This has worked almost perfectly but I think the center ring could use some tweaking as it clogs with chaff on some roasts.
This is a great addition to the SR800 Roaster and it fits perfectly. I used it so I can install temperature probes to record the roasting profile in the Artisan software and this lid extension works perfect for that, especially since it already has 2 probe ports build in. They are plugged, but you can just push them out and install your probes and not have to damage the metal lid from the roaster. I used it several times now and it withstands the temperatures very nicely without and deformation or cracking. So if you need more headspace for chaff collecting and/or want to install temperature probes, this is a must have for the SR800 roaster.

Did 3 roasts yesterday with it and the SR800 with extension tube and chaff extender. The chaff extender dramatically increases air flow through the unit. This is good but you have to increase heat to make up for it.
Without the extender I would end up at 6 fan and 6 heat. With extender 6 fan and 8 heat (I use a thermocouple)
Without the extender the sr800 would clog quickly. No clogging with the extender.
I’m guessing it’s 3d printed but the materials seem very good!
It doesn’t make chaff emptying any different. But you have to remember to put the center baffle back in.
